Product Description:
The R2AA05010FXP9G Servo Motor originates from Sanyo Denki as a product device of the industrial automation system. The device is designed to utilize a 200V AC supply. The motor operates efficiently when used between 0 to +40°C temperature conditions. The control power supply operates at 40 VA. The amplifier power supply accepts power between 100V to 115V AC.
The R2AA05010FXP9G servomotor has a specified working range of ±15% below and up to 10% above 50/60Hz frequencies within a 3-Hz range. The Servo Motor reaches its maximum power production of 100 W. The output capability enables tight-torque systems to use compact setups. The device provides ratings for rated torque at 0.318 Nm. The continuous stall torque amounts to the same value as the rated stall torque. Continuous load requires these values to enable the steadiness of torque production. The motor operates at a speed rating of 3000 min⁻¹. Standard automation solutions, along with positioning systems, find an appropriate fit with this operating speed. The rotating rigid body element of R2AA05010FXP9G servomotor has a component of 0.117 * 10^-4 kilogram-meter squared (kg*m^2). The designed rotational control remains stable when machines begin and stop operations quickly.
Installation of the R2AA05010FXP9G servomotor occurs through flange mounting for stability purposes. This motor holds an IP67 protection standard. The weight of the motor assembly, along with the encoder, amounts to 0.71 kilograms. The motor exhibits a 4.8-ohm value of phase resistance. Stable currents during motor operation result partly from the phase resistance. The main circuit power supply rated for operation is 0.3 kVA. The brake utilizes two current levels of 0.07 A and 0.27 A according to the specification. This brake accepts powered voltages of DC 90V with DC 24V that can operate with ±10% variation.
